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between APIVerve and Flow?

To start, connect both your APIVerve and Flow acc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in APIVerve triggers actions in Flow (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from APIVerve is recorded in Flow?

Absolutely. You can customize how APIVerve data is recorded in Flow. This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of Flow, set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between APIVerve and Flow?

The data sync between APIVerve and Flow typ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from APIVerve to Flow?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between APIVerve and Flow?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between APIVerve and Flow. For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About Flow

GetFlow is a task and project management tool designed to help teams collaborate efficiently and manage their workflows effectively. It offers features such as task assignments, due dates, project timelines, and team communication to streamline project management processes.
